Monoclonal Antibody-Based Serological Detection Methods for Wheat Dwarf Virus.

Minghao Zhang1, Rui Chen1, Xueping Zhou2,3

  • 1State Key Laboratory of Rice Biology, Institute of Biotechnology, Zhejiang University, Hangzhou, 310058, China.

Virologica Sinica
|April 11, 2018
PubMed
Summary

Researchers developed sensitive serological assays to detect wheat dwarf virus (WDV) in wheat. These methods, using monoclonal antibodies, identified WDV in 62% of surveyed Chinese wheat samples, aiding disease control efforts.

Area of Science:

  • Plant pathology
  • Virology
  • Immunotechnology

Background:

  • Wheat dwarf virus (WDV) causes significant yield losses in wheat crops across China.
  • Existing detection methods may lack the sensitivity or efficiency required for widespread disease management.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To develop and validate reliable and effective serological detection methods for WDV.
  • To assess the prevalence of WDV in wheat-growing regions of China.

Main Methods:

  • Cloning and expression of the WDV coat protein (CP) gene in E. coli.
  • Production of anti-WDV monoclonal antibodies (MAbs) using hybridoma technology.
  • Establishment and optimization of antigen-coated-plate ELISA (ACP-ELISA) and dot-ELISA using developed MAbs.

Main Results:

  • Four hybridoma cell lines secreting anti-WDV MAbs were successfully generated.
  • Highly sensitive ACP-ELISA (up to 1:163,840 dilution) and dot-ELISA (up to 1:5,120 dilution) were established.
  • Serological assays detected WDV in 62% of 128 wheat samples from Shaanxi and Qinghai provinces, China, with results validated by PCR and sequencing.

Conclusions:

  • The developed ACP-ELISA and dot-ELISA are highly sensitive and effective for WDV detection in wheat.
  • These serological methods offer significant utility for the surveillance and control of WDV in China.
